If you have a pet such as a dog or anything else, this is an important factor to consider with a new fence, and you will have to determine if you want the fence to contain your pet so it can run freely in your garden. You really do have other options beside getting a chain fence in this situation, and just talk to the contractor. The important thing here is that the dog won't get out or jump the fence plus you want it to be safe for your pet.
